A Ferrari 365GTB/4 Daytona will be among the automotive stars at H&H's April 21 auction in Buxton, UK.
An early "Plexiglass" model, the car is just one of 158 examples supplied to the UK.
Held in single family ownership until 2001, the Daytona comes with a fascinating file of correspondence between its first custodian and the Ferrari parts specialist, Maranello Concessionaires.

This historic Ferrari's features and restorations include air conditioning, fitted by Maranello, and an engine overhaul some 10,000 miles ago.
Since then, more recent work has included a bare metal re-spray.
The classic 365GTB/4 will roll onto the auction block with an estimate of £155,000-175,000.
In other Ferrari news, the second highest lot at RM Auction's recent major Automobiles of Amelia Island sale was a Fly Yellow spraypainted 1967 Ferrari 275 GTB/4 Berlinetta, sold for $1,650,000.
